Transaction 2df63a481d4fc33f87d89e79950bdbb899c68e80987e104b0d051b68e09ebadd

1 Input
2 Outputs
  • 2df63a481d4fc33f87d89e79950bdbb899c68e80987e104b0d051b68e09ebadd:0
  • value  3261022
    address  3JkSWAEXejbvGihbwdrNTgrM4qDS14eiEh
  • 2df63a481d4fc33f87d89e79950bdbb899c68e80987e104b0d051b68e09ebadd:1
  • value  448923319
    address  17WxukCJViLLyHqJSW98ggCAN8mPvdUyPy